Understanding the Unique Characteristics of Kochia

Kochia, scientifically known as Kochia scoparia, is a member of the Amaranthaceae family and is native to Eurasia. Its ability to thrive in arid and semi-arid regions, coupled with its resilience to drought and high temperatures, make it a particularly valuable crop for the diverse climatic conditions of Tamil Nadu.

One of the standout features of Kochia is its versatility. This plant can be utilized for a wide range of purposes, including animal feed, biofuel production, and even as a source of valuable nutrients for human consumption. Its high content of protein, minerals, and antioxidants has garnered the attention of nutritionists and health enthusiasts alike.

Expert Guide: Best Practices for Kochia Cultivation in Tamil Nadu

Cultivating Kochia in Tamil Nadu requires a nuanced approach that takes into account the region’s unique climatic conditions and soil characteristics. Our team of agricultural experts has compiled the following best practices to ensure the success of your Kochia cultivation endeavors:

Site Selection and Soil Preparation

  • Choose a well-drained, sandy or loamy soil that is rich in organic matter.
  • Ensure the soil pH is slightly alkaline, ranging between 7.0 and 8.5.
  • Prepare the soil by tilling and incorporating organic matter, such as compost or well-rotted manure, to improve soil fertility and water-holding capacity.

Planting and Sowing

  • Sow Kochia seeds directly into the prepared soil, either in rows or broadcasting, during the appropriate planting season (typically April-May in Tamil Nadu).
  • Maintain a spacing of 30-45 cm between rows and 15-20 cm between plants within the row.
  • Ensure the seeds are planted at a depth of 1-2 cm and cover them lightly with soil.

Irrigation and Water Management

  • Kochia is a drought-tolerant crop, but it still requires regular, light irrigation, especially during the seedling and early growth stages.
  • Avoid waterlogging, as Kochia is susceptible to root rot and other fungal diseases in overly moist conditions.
  • Consider implementing water-saving techniques, such as drip irrigation or mulching, to optimize water usage and promote efficient water management.

Nutrient Management

  • Conduct a soil test to determine the nutrient profile of your land and tailor your fertilizer application accordingly.
  • Apply a balanced, slow-release organic fertilizer during the initial stages of growth to support the plant’s establishment and early development.
  • Monitor the crop’s nutrient status throughout the growing season and make targeted applications of additional nutrients as needed.

Pest and Disease Management

  • Closely monitor the crop for common pests and diseases, such as aphids, spider mites, and fungal infections.
  • Adopt an integrated pest management (IPM) approach, utilizing a combination of cultural, biological, and, if necessary, selective chemical controls.
  • Maintain good sanitation practices, such as removing weeds and debris, to minimize the risk of pest and disease outbreaks.

Harvesting and Post-Harvest Handling

  • Harvest Kochia when the plants have reached the desired maturity, typically 90-120 days after sowing.
  • Carefully cut the plants at the base, leaving a short stubble, and dry them in a well-ventilated area.
  • Store the harvested Kochia in a cool, dry place to maintain quality and maximize shelf life.

Diversify Your Crop Rotation

Incorporate Kochia into a well-designed crop rotation system that includes other hardy, drought-resistant crops. This not only helps maintain soil health but also provides a buffer against the risks associated with unpredictable weather patterns and climate change.

Explore Value-Added Processing

Kochia’s versatility extends beyond its use as animal feed or a biofuel feedstock. Investigate the potential for value-added processing, such as extracting high-value compounds for nutraceutical or cosmetic applications. This can significantly enhance the overall profitability of your Kochia cultivation endeavors.

Engage in Collaborative Research

Partner with local universities, research institutes, or agricultural extension services to stay informed about the latest advancements in Kochia cultivation and processing. Participate in field trials, workshops, and knowledge-sharing initiatives to learn from the experts and contribute to the ongoing development of this remarkable crop.

Prioritize Sustainability and Ecological Harmony

Adopt sustainable farming practices that minimize the environmental impact of Kochia cultivation. This might include exploring organic or regenerative agriculture techniques, implementing water conservation strategies, and promoting biodiversity on your farm. By aligning your efforts with the principles of ecological sustainability, you can contribute to the long-term viability of Kochia cultivation in Tamil Nadu.
